#vinylrecords #vinyl #records #vinyljunkie #U2 U2 - The Joshua Tree (1987) What do Austria, Canada, France, Germany, New Zealand, Switzerland, Sweden, the UK, the Netherlands and the USA have in common? This album went to #1 on the charts in each of those countries. 1,000,000 copies sold in Canada and Germany, almost 3 million in the UK, and TEN million in the USA. That is not too shabby of a performance. Two #1 hits ("With or Without You" & "I Still Haven't Found What I'm Looking For") and "Where the Streets Have No Name" reached #13 in the USA.
